Emerald Advisors, LLC: Paraplanner Opportunity

We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Paraplanner to join our team of professionals at Emerald Advisors, LLC. As a Paraplanner, you will play a critical role in providing purpose-driven wealth management to high-net-worth clients.

This is an excellent opportunity to learn from experienced professionals, grow your career, and contribute to a thriving business from the ground up. Our ideal candidate will possess high attention to detail, strong analytical skills, a fiduciary mindset, and a focus on providing world-class customer service.

Responsibilities:
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date client data in CRM and financial planning tools.
  • Work closely with senior team members to collect and analyze client data for use in developing and presenting financial plans.
  • Prepare high-quality slides for client proposals and annual review meetings.
  • Coordinate post-meeting follow-ups to ensure seamless client experiences.
  • Assist in client onboarding and account opening processes.
  • Support advisors in managing current and prospective client relationships.
  • Stay current on industry trends, regulations, and best practices in financial planning.
Requirements:
  • 1-3 years of experience in a similar role in the financial services industry.
  • High level of organization and attention to detail.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and prioritize effectively.
  • Strong communication skills, including written correspondence.
  • Team player with a collaborative mindset and ability to work well with others.
  • Passion for helping clients and commitment to maintaining confidentiality.
  • Bachelor's degree, preferably in finance or business.
  • Demonstrated ability to think critically on a strategic level, take initiative, and problem-solve.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int. Experience with eMoney and/or Redtail a plus.
Benefits:
  • Competitive salary plus bonus opportunities.
  • 401(k) with company contribution.
  • Medical, dental, vision, and life insurance.
  • Ongoing career development, including training, certification, and tuition reimbursement.
  • Free parking.
  • 10 paid holidays plus 3 weeks of PTO.
